What is Image Labeling?

Image labeling is the process of annotating images with data that provides context and meaning. It assigns identifiable tags to visuals, ensuring that images are categorized correctly and can be easily retrieved when needed. This technique is invaluable across various industries, including those offering home services like locksmiths and key reproduction specialists.

2. Utilize Metadata

Metadata plays a vital role in image labeling as it helps search engines understand the context of your images. Be sure to include:

  • Alt Text: Brief descriptions that provide context for visually impaired users and aid in SEO.
  • Captions: Detailed descriptions under each image to explain what customers are seeing.
  • File Names: Use descriptive names for image files, such as "high-security-lock.jpg" instead of "IMG1234.jpg".
